NYU School of Professional Studies
Academy for Grantmaking & Funder Education
The Academy is the nation's oldest and most comprehensive university based program exclusively teaching philanthropists and foundation professionals; since its inception participants have come from 23 nations and across the United States. Philanthropy Advisors and Community Foundation professionals may wish to consider earning the Certificate in Philanthropy and Grantmaking, a valuable credential in the field.
